Located within the Melbourne Museum, the Bunjilaka Aboriginal Cultural Centre offers an immersive and educational experience into the rich cultural history and traditions of Australia’s Indigenous peoples. Just a short drive from Pullman & Mercure Melbourne Albert Park, this unique cultural destination is a must-visit for those looking to explore the history, art, and storytelling of the First Nations peoples.
At Bunjilaka, you’ll find a variety of exhibits showcasing the diversity of Aboriginal culture, including traditional tools, art, and objects, along with contemporary Indigenous works. One of the centre’s highlights is the Bunjil – a spiritual figure represented as an eagle, deeply significant to many Indigenous cultures. Through both permanent and rotating exhibitions, Bunjilaka brings the stories of the Koorie people to life, offering visitors a deep, respectful understanding of Indigenous heritage and traditions.
The centre also hosts a variety of interactive workshops, cultural performances, and storytelling sessions, allowing you to engage directly with Indigenous artists and educators.
